HRES 82 United States House · 119th Congress

Providing amounts for the expenses of the Committee on Oversight and Government Reform in the One Hundred Nineteenth Congress.

HRES 82 is a procedural resolution that allocates $32.86 million in funding for the Committee on Oversight and Government Reform during the 119th Congress (2025-2027). The resolution specifies $15.9 million for expenses in the first year (2025) and $16.96 million for the second year (2026), covering staff salaries and operational costs. This resolution solely addresses committee budgeting and does not create new policy or affect any constituents.
